[0017] Hereinafter, preferred embodiments of the present invention will be described in detail with reference to the accompanying drawings.

[0018] image 3 is a partial sectional view of the tire of the present invention, Figure 4 It is an enlarged perspective view of the main part of the decoupling groove of the present invention.

[0019] Such as image 3 and Figure 4 As shown, the pneumatic tire for load bearing of the present invention includes a tread portion 1, a sidewall portion 2 and a bead portion 3, and a decoupling groove 5 is formed on the shoulder portion 12 of the tread portion 1, wherein, in the decoupling A tie bar 6 is formed inside the groove 5 .

[0020] The present invention having the above-mentioned structure functions to increase the rigidity of the shoulder outer rib, to prevent rib separation and damage, and to prevent damage to the appearance of the decoupling groove 5, so that it can be fully secured even in the late stage of wear. Abstract

The invention provides a pneumatic tire for load bearing, which comprises a tread part (1), a sidewall part (2) and a bead part (3), and a decoupling The groove (5) is characterized in that tie bars (6) are formed inside the decoupling groove (5). This prevents abnormal wear on the shoulder ribs, and greatly prolongs the life of the tire.

Description

technical field [0001] The present invention relates to a pneumatic tire for heavy loads, and more specifically, to a pneumatic tire for heavy loads in which the structure of the decoupling groove (Decoupling Groove) formed on the shoulder portion is improved so as to prevent the Abnormal wear that occurs intensively. Background technique [0002] In general, in pneumatic tires for trucks and buses, the wear performance and abnormal wear performance of the tire can be said to be the most important issues. [0003] Pneumatic tires for heavy trucks can be roughly classified into a rib pattern and a block pattern according to the pattern shape of the tread portion. [0004] Block tires have the advantage of making the braking performance of the vehicle better.
